History of metallurgy in the Indian subcontinent - Wikipedia

The history of metallurgy in the Indian subcontinent began prior to the 3rd millennium BCE and continued well into the British Raj. Metals and related concepts were mentioned in various early Vedic age texts. The Rigveda already uses the Sanskrit term Ayas(आयस) (metal). Socio-economic Impact of Mining on Rural Communities

In India, more than 25 million people have been displaced due to development projects and about 12 % are due to mining industries-2.5 million (1951-2000). Only 24.7% persons got rehabilitation.

IBM- Indian Bureau of Mines

The Indian Bureau of Mines (IBM) established in 1948, is a multi-disciplinary government organisation under the Department of Mines, Ministry of Mines, engaged in promotion of conservation, scientific development of mineral resources and protection of environment in mines other than coal, petroleum & natural gas, atomic minerals and minor minerals.
